Веб-пуш уведомления – это эффективный способ привлечь внимание посетителей и удержать их на вашем сайте. Они позволяют отправлять сообщения пользователям непосредственно на их устройства, даже если они не активно используют вашу веб-страницу.
Настройка веб-пуш уведомлений может показаться сложной задачей, но с нашей подробной инструкцией вы сможете освоить этот процесс без проблем. В этой статье мы расскажем вам о самых важных шагах, которые вам потребуется выполнить, чтобы успешно запустить веб-пуш уведомления на вашем сайте.
Шаг 1: Получите SSL-сертификат
Перед тем, как начать настройку веб-пуш уведомлений, убедитесь, что у вас есть SSL-сертификат. SSL-сертификат обеспечивает защищенное соединение между вашим сервером и устройствами пользователей. Большинство браузеров требует наличия SSL-сертификата для поддержки веб-пуш уведомлений.
Примечание: если у вас еще нет SSL-сертификата, обратитесь к своему хостинг-провайдеру или доступным онлайн-ресурсам для получения подробной информации о том, как получить и установить SSL-сертификат на вашем сервере.
Шаг 2: Выберите платформу веб-пуш уведомлений
Следующим шагом является выбор платформы веб-пуш уведомлений, которая будет работать на вашем сайте. Существует множество платформ, предлагающих различные функции и возможности. Проанализируйте их и выберите ту, которая наиболее соответствует вашим потребностям и бюджету.
Важно удостовериться, что выбранная вами платформа веб-пуш уведомлений поддерживает вашу CMS (Content Management System), если вы используете систему управления контентом для своего сайта. Это позволит вам интегрировать уведомления с вашей CMS и управлять ими непосредственно из нее.
Регистрация домена
Домен - это уникальное имя, по которому пользователи смогут обращаться к вашему веб-сайту. Например, если вы хотите создать веб-пуш уведомления для своего магазина, то можете зарегистрировать домен вида "mymagazin.ru".
Для регистрации домена нужно выбрать и зарегистрировать его у провайдера услуги доменных имен. Есть множество компаний, предлагающих услуги регистрации доменов. Вам потребуется выбрать провайдера, узнать его цены и правила регистрации, а затем зарегистрировать нужное вам доменное имя.
Совет: При выборе домена старайтесь выбирать короткие и запоминающиеся имена, которые легко вводятся и запоминаются пользователями.
Примечание: Регистрация домена может быть платной и потребовать ежегодной оплаты. Также обратите внимание, что многие популярные доменные имена могут быть заняты, поэтому стоит придумать несколько вариантов и провести их проверку на доступность.
Создание SSL сертификата
- Выберите поставщика SSL-сертификатов. Существует множество компаний, предлагающих услуги по созданию и установке SSL-сертификатов. Изучите отзывы и рейтинги, чтобы выбрать надежного поставщика.
- Получите сертификат. Заполните все необходимые данные и оплатите услугу получения SSL-сертификата. Также вам может потребоваться предоставить дополнительные документы для проверки подлинности вашего веб-сайта.
- Установите SSL-сертификат на вашем веб-сервере. Это может потребовать выполнения некоторых технических действий в зависимости от используемого сервера. Обратитесь к документации вашего сервера или обратитесь за помощью к вашему хостинг-провайдеру.
- Проверьте работу SSL-сертификата. После установки сертификата убедитесь, что ваш веб-сайт открывается по протоколу HTTPS и отображает зеленый замок в адресной строке браузера, что свидетельствует о безопасном подключении.
После создания и установки SSL-сертификата ваш веб-сайт будет обеспечен защищенным соединением, что повысит доверие пользователей и обеспечит безопасность передачи данных.
Выбор платформы для веб-пуш уведомлений
При настройке веб-пуш уведомлений важно правильно выбрать платформу, которая будет управлять процессом отправки уведомлений пользователю. Существует несколько популярных платформ, которые предлагают различные функции и возможности.
Платформа | Описание |
---|---|
OneSignal | OneSignal - мощная и простая в использовании платформа, которая предлагает бесплатный план с ограниченными возможностями и платные планы с дополнительными функциями, такими как расписание уведомлений и тестирование. |
Pushwoosh | Pushwoosh - еще одна популярная платформа с широкими возможностями. Она предлагает бесплатный тарифный план для небольших проектов и платные планы с расширенными функциями, такими как сегментация пользователей и монетизация. |
Web Push Notifications | Web Push Notifications - это открытая платформа, которая может быть установлена и настроена на вашем сервере. Она предоставляет полный контроль над процессом отправки уведомлений и не имеет ограничений на количество пользователей. |
При выборе платформы для веб-пуш уведомлений необходимо учитывать свои потребности и требования проекта. Платформа должна быть надежной, легкой в использовании и предоставлять необходимые функции для отправки уведомлений и управления подписчиками.
Установка скрипта для веб-пуш уведомлений
Для настройки веб-пуш уведомлений на вашем веб-сайте вам потребуется установить специальный скрипт. В этом разделе мы рассмотрим, как это сделать.
1. Вам потребуется доступ к файлам вашего веб-сайта. Если вы используете платформу управления контентом, такую как WordPress или Joomla, вам может потребоваться административный доступ.
2. Зарегистрируйтесь на платформе веб-пуш уведомлений, такой как OneSignal или PushCrew. Создайте аккаунт и получите необходимые API-ключи. Как правило, вам потребуется добавить ваш домен в настройках аккаунта.
3. После получения API-ключей, вам нужно будет вставить соответствующие коды в разные части вашего веб-сайта. Обычно это делается внутри секции <head>
и перед закрывающим тегом </body>
.
4. Создайте новый файл на вашем сервере и назовите его push.js
. Вставьте следующий код в файл push.js
:
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
<script src="https://cdn.onesignal.com/sdks/OneSignalSDK.js" async=""></script>
<script>
var OneSignal = window.OneSignal